Under California's Fair Employment and Housing Act (FEHA), which group is protected in addition to the federal seven?
APet owners
BMarital status and sexual orientation✓ Correct
CCollege students
DInvestors
Explanation
California's FEHA provides broader fair housing protections than federal law, adding marital status, sexual orientation, gender identity, gender expression, source of income, and ancestry as additional protected characteristics.
